How Much Does a Bachelor’s in Economics from San Diego Mesa College Cost?

$1,150 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

San Diego Mesa College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

Out-of-state part-time undergraduates at San Diego Mesa College paid an average of $377 per credit hour in 2022-2023. The average for in-state students was $46 per credit hour. The average full-time tuition and fees for undergraduates are shown in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$1,104 $9,048
Fees $46 $46
Books and Supplies $938 $938

San Diego Mesa College Economics Associate’s Program Diversity

Of the 13 students who earned an associate's degree in Economics from San Diego Mesa College in 2021-2022, 69% were men and 31% were women.
